Safety Information
Read all safety warnings and instructions before using this product.
Keep this instruction manual for future reference.
The term "power tool" in the warnings refers to your mains-operated (corded) power tool or battery-operated (cordless) power tool.
Work area safety:
- Keep work area clean and well lit. Cluttered or dark areas invite accidents.
- Do not operate power tools in explosive atmospheres, such as in the presence of flammable liquids, gases or dust. Power tools create sparks which may ignite the dust or fumes.
- Keep children and bystanders away while operating a power tool. Distractions can cause you to lose control.
Electrical safety:
- Power tool plugs must match the outlet. Never modify the plug in any way. Do not use any adapter plugs with earthed (grounded) power tools. Unmodified plugs and matching outlets will reduce risk of electric shock.
- Avoid body contact with earthed or grounded surfaces such as pipes, radiators, ranges and refrigerators. There is an increased risk of electric shock if your body is earthed or grounded.
- Do not expose power tools to rain or wet conditions. Water entering a power tool will increase the risk of electric shock.
Personal safety:
- Stay alert, watch what you are doing and use common sense when operating a power tool. Do not use a power tool while you are tired or under the influence of drugs, alcohol or medication.
- Wear personal protective equipment. Always wear eye protection. Dust mask, non-slip footwear, hard hat, ear protection and gloves are required for certain operations.
- Prevent unintentional starting. Ensure the switch is in the "OFF" position before connecting to power source and/or picking up or carrying the tool.
- Remove adjusting keys or wrenches before turning the power tool on. A wrench or key left attached to a rotating part of the tool may cause injury.
- Do not overreach. Keep proper footing and balance at all times.
- Dress properly. Do not wear loose clothing or jewelry. Keep hair, clothing and gloves away from moving parts.
- Use the right tool for the job. Do not force a power tool to do a job it was not designed to do.
- Use the correct accessories. Only use accessories that are designed for use with your specific power tool.
- Keep tools sharp and clean. Properly maintained tools are less likely to bind and are easier to control.
- Store idle power tools out of the reach of children and other untrained persons.
- When servicing, use only identical replacement parts.
